Kamen Rider OOO
Of the three Rider series I've watched from beginning to end, Den-O's still my number one, but OOO is one hell of a close second. Eiji and Ankh's relationship was one of the biggest highlights, having a much different--but still extremely fun--dynamic from Ryotaro and the Taros or Shotaro and Philip. The Greeed are probably my favourite villains so far, and I look forward to seeing if any of the other shows' secondary Riders are as loveable as Date.
I also think that OOO's transformations are all my favourites to date, especially PU! TO! TYRA! Great designs all around for this one.
